Name of Property: Former site of  Beeson Street Bar & Grill

Address: 105 Beeson Street

Owner: Vic Kuiper

To Schedule Showing: Call the property owner directly. 

Asking Price: 

Property Description: The two-story, double-storefront is located downtown across from Beckwith Park.  It was the site of a long-time established business.

It provides the opportunity for two businesses with bar on one side, café on other side, with a common modern & commercial kitchen, including quality stainless steel fixtures & appliances, walk-in cooler and ample storage areas.  The large and separate tiled restrooms are in good condition.  The building has a partial basement.

The second floor offers great potential for additional multi-unit apartments for additional income.  The City's Rental Rehab Program is available to provide renovation assistance, as well as the DDA's Facade Incentive Program to renovate the exterior.  Interior is clean throughout with public parking adjacent to this site.

    Dowagiac Home & Garden Tour 2024 tickets available May 8

    Dowagiac, MI - May 8, 2024 - The Greater Dowagiac Chamber of Commerce is delighted to announce the highly anticipated return of the Dowagiac Home & Garden Tour, scheduled for June 22, 2024. From 10 a.m. to 3 p.m., attendees will have the opportunity to explore six of Dowagiac's most historic and picturesque properties, showcasing the architectural variety and historic charm of the region.

    Destination Dowagiac Events and Membership Directory available now!

    The 2024 edition of the Dowagiac Chamber of Commerce publication, Destination Dowagiac, is now available for free distribution at numerous Cass and Berrien County businesses, the Chamber of Commerce office, as well as at Pure Michigan Welcome Centers across Michigan.

    This guide not only contains the Chamber's Business Member Directory, but also a calendar of local events and festivals.  Highlighting places to stay, play, shop and dine, the directory serves as a guide for both visitors and local residents.
